Vine landscapes

Segonzano, Faver, Grauno, Grumes, Valda, Cembra, Lisignago

A journey into the essence of Val di Cembra: the small villages on steep slopes, the terraced vineyards, the Avisio stream, and the Segonzano Castle.

Our route starts from the center of Faver and crosses the village following the signs of the European Path E5 along the historic Corvaia Way, which descends to the Cantilaga bridge over the Avisio, for centuries the only passable connection between the two banks.

Along the descent via the paved mule track, we meet the "Capitello della Madonna delle Grazie". According to a legend, this was the place of the "Om Selvàdech" (wild man), a kind of gnome who came out of the woods and amused himself by scaring passing women, chasing them with screams and shouts.

You then reach the Cantilaga Bridge, first mentioned in 1472 and destroyed in 1630 to prevent the spread of the plague that had affected the Faver side. After various reconstructions, the current bridge was built in 2007. From Cantilaga Bridge, turn right towards Piazzo: near the cemetery, a left turn allows reaching the ruins of the medieval Segonzano Castle.

Then descend to the hamlet of Piazzo, where the small church of the Immaculate Conception, built in the 1500s in late gothic style over a pre-existing chapel dating back to around 1130, is worth a visit. Here is preserved a valuable wooden statue depicting the Madonna of the Grapes. From Piazzo, descend along the provincial road to the "Friendship Bridge" over the Avisio. After crossing the bridge, immediately turn left taking the secondary road that runs along the stream. Along country roads among the vineyards, we ascend back to Faver.
